Sulfinol-X – Leveraging the advantages of well-proven and established technologies in a single acid gas removal process

Gerard van der Zwet et al. – SGS, The Netherlands

Sulfinol-X is a technology development for Acid Gas Removal based on long-term design and operational experience with both traditional hybrid solvents such as Sulfinol-D and accelerated MDEA solvents. Case studies are presented showing the potential benefits of Sulfinol-X, both for revamps of existing and design of new plants. Benefits include increased capacity, energy reduction, lower chemicals consumption and waste disposal, tighter CO2, H2S and COS specifications and simplified process schemes. For new plants the case demonstrates that simplicity and reliability can be realized with Sulfinol-X, while reducing CAPEX significantly compared to traditional accelerated MDEA schemes for highly contaminated gases. Two examples are presented utilizing the Sulfinol-X technology, demonstrating the predicted advantages and long term stability of the new solvent.
